3. See to it your neighbors are all right with you starting a doggie childcare.
If you have neighbors that do not like the concept of canines running around and barking all day, they might complain to the city, and you could be compelled to close down your business. This is why you must ensure to chat with your neighbors prior to starting a pet day care.

You should additionally ensure to have a look at your regional regulations and policies pertaining to running a day care from home. Several cities won't permit you to run a commercial organization from a residentially-zoned residential property, so you may require to get your home re-zoned or discover another area for your day care.

Lastly, you need to also take a look at your competition in the location. This will assist you determine what you require to do to compete with them, such as using a specific service they do not offer or organizing events for your clients. 4. Make sure your home is risk-free
Make certain that all outdoor areas are devoid of flowers and plants that could be harmful to pet dogs, such as azaleas, lilies and daffodils. Instead, select dog-friendly plants that use aesthetic appeal, such as sunflowers or petunias. You'll likewise wish to see to it that all gateways, barriers and other dogs boarding near me security attributes are secure. It's a great concept to have double-entry barriers to ensure that pets can not leave from the outdoors area and end up being shed in your property.

Ensure to develop a secure environment by offering lots of playthings and interactive equipment. This will assist to involve and stimulate canines, while maintaining them secure from each other. Agility devices is a superb way to burn off energy, while challenge toys can maintain dogs busy during quieter durations of the day.
